Rolling, in technology, the principal method of forming molten metals, glass, or other substances into shapes that are small in cross-section in comparison with their length, such as bars, sheets, rods, rails, girders, and wires. Rolling is the most widely used method of shaping metals and is particularly important in the manufacture of steel for use in construction and other industries.

In the metalworking rolling process in hot and cold rolling mills, heat is generated by friction and deformation in the mechanical forming of the rolling stock. As a result, efficient cooling of the rolls as well as the surrounding roll area is essential for the forming process in order to ensure stable roll temperatures and effective heat ...

John G. Lenard, in Primer on Flat Rolling (Second Edition), 2014. 3.5 Friction and Wear. Work rolls in hot strip mills wear due to friction between the roll surface and hot strip. (Back-up rolls wear as well, but under pressure with elastic deformation, the friction is much less, except for the high work roll roughness in the last stand of a sheet rolling tandem cold mill).

STECKEL MILL — SPECIALIZED SOLUTIONS THROUGH ENGINEERING EXPERIENCE The Steckel Mill occupies a special niche in hot flat rolling, operating at a lower economic volume than tandem hot strip mills but capable of greater widths and especially suitable for particular alloys, including stainless steels.

In hot strip finish rolling, a commonly occurring problem is that the tail end of a strip steel sheet walks and that its edge touches the side guide on the entry side of the next rolling mill stand after it comes off a rolling mill stand and buckles the edge, which is then folded and rolled by the next rolling mill stand (Photo 1).
